World Book Day will mark 30 years of literary fun in 2025. Unesco, which promotes global education, culture and heritage, created the annual event on April 23, 1995. Since then, it has become a worldwide movement celebrating books and encouraging children to read. Some experts say the biggest indicator of a child’s future success is whether they read for pleasure. They say this matters more than family circumstances, parents’ income, or educational background.
